Gifted students tell of their delight at getting top marks

- Robin Schiller

FOUR gifted students earned top marks across the board in this year’s Junior Cert exams.

The top honour students expressed their shock and delight at securing the highest grades in all their exams.

Eimear Kennedy (15), from Newmarket-on-Fergus, Co Clare, revealed her joy at securing 12 of the best marks possible in her subjects.

The St Caimin’s Community School student, who is now in fifth year in the school, hopes to go on to study computer science or business at university.

“I’m very happy with it, I still haven’t taken it in,” she said.

“I don’t think anyone can really expect to get 12 top marks, so it was a shock when I looked at the results. I have really great teachers and a great principal here, which has really helped. When I leave school I would like to do computer science or a business course.”

Meanwhile, Tipperary student Isobel Quirk was also “completely shocked” when she opened her results.

“I thought I did well in geography, history and CSPE. After that, I didn’t know if I was coming or going.

“I couldn’t believe it. I really couldn’t. My parents were really happy. Actually, I think they were happier than I was,” she said.

The 16-year-old student boards at Clochar Na Nursulach in Thurles, Co Tipperary.

“I put in about two or three hours of study each evening. I’m boarding at the school so they

schedule those hours of study for all of us,” she said.

“I also do a lot of sport so that helps a bit with stress relief.”

Another student to earn top marks was Niall O’Donnell (15) from Summerhill College, Co Sligo, who modestly stated he “did fairly well”.

“It was a huge surprise. I wasn’t expecting it at all. I did a bit [of study] after school but I didn’t kill myself. I’m in the local swimming club so I do about eight hours of swimming there each week.”

“Transition year is great because you get to do a lot of different projects. I’m really looking forward to getting my mini company going,” he said.
